Output 52f249281a27066b46128a9cafcd23499f0ef06e7a661d53ca2fd3bdd7cd2490:147

value
30883
script pubkey
OP_0 OP_PUSHBYTES_20 bc66afb305789881a3f9698545536423236c04d4
address
bc1qh3n2lvc90zvgrgledxz525myyv3kcpx5svqak6
transaction
52f249281a27066b46128a9cafcd23499f0ef06e7a661d53ca2fd3bdd7cd2490
spent
true